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. **What is a phenol peel?**
A phenol peel is a type of chemical peel that uses phenol, a strong acid, to remove the outer layers of the skin. It is used to treat severe sun damage, wrinkles, and some types of acne scars.
2. **How long does a phenol peel procedure take?**
The procedure typically takes about 1 to 2 hours, depending on the extent of the treatment area.
3. **What is the recovery time after a phenol peel?**
Recovery time can vary, but it generally takes about 2 to 4 weeks for the skin to heal completely.
4. **Are there any risks or side effects associated with phenol peels?**
Potential side effects include redness, swelling, and sensitivity. More severe complications are rare but can include infection or scarring.
5. **Can I drive myself home after the procedure?**
No, it is recommended to have someone drive you home after the procedure due to the potential effects of the anesthesia used.
